Polychlorinated biphenyls (PCBs)(Arochlors)

Polychlorinated biphenyls (PCBs) are a group of chemicals that contain 209 individual compounds (known as congeners) with varying harmful effects. Information on specific congener toxicity is very limited. The public health implications of polychlorinated biphenyls (PCBs) in the environment.

Polychlorinated biphenyls (PCBs) were widely used in various industrial applications. Research confirmed that some PCB congeners degrade slowly in the environment and can build up in the food chain.
